Seattle Brands: From Coffee to Tech Giants
Seattle is home to a surprising number of globally recognized brands. From the ubiquitous Starbucks to the tech behemoth Amazon, Seattle’s innovative spirit has spawned companies that dominate various industries.
The Coffee King: Starbucks
No discussion of Seattle brands is complete without mentioning Starbucks. Founded in 1971 at Pike Place Market, Starbucks has become synonymous with coffee culture worldwide. What began as a small coffee bean roaster has transformed into a global empire with thousands of stores in numerous countries. The success of Starbucks can be attributed to its focus on the customer experience, its commitment to quality coffee, and its strategic expansion.
Tech Titan: Amazon
Amazon, founded by Jeff Bezos in 1994, began as an online bookstore but rapidly expanded to become the world’s largest online retailer and a leader in cloud computing. The company’s headquarters in Seattle is a major economic driver for the city. Amazon’s influence extends beyond retail, encompassing cloud services (Amazon Web Services, AWS), digital streaming (Prime Video), and artificial intelligence. Outdoor Gear Powerhouse: REI
Recreational Equipment, Inc., commonly known as REI, is a cooperative specializing in outdoor recreation gear, sporting goods, and apparel. Founded in 1938, REI has a long history of serving outdoor enthusiasts. Its commitment to sustainability and its cooperative ownership structure distinguish it from other retailers. REI has a strong presence in the Pacific Northwest and operates stores throughout the United States.
Airlines : Boeing
Boeing has had a significant presence in Seattle, Washington since 1916. Boeing Commercial Airplanes is headquartered in Seattle. The company employs over 136,000 people across the United States and in more than 65 countries. Boeing designs, manufactures, and sells airplanes, rockets, satellites, telecommunications equipment, and missiles.
Other Notable Seattle Brands
Beyond these giants, other significant brands call Seattle home. Nordstrom, a high-end department store chain, was founded in Seattle in 1901. Costco Wholesale, a membership-only warehouse club, has its headquarters in Issaquah, Washington, near Seattle. These companies contribute to Seattle’s diverse and thriving economy.
